GSA Capital Partners LLP cut its holdings in shares of Energizer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:ENR - Free Report) by 36.5%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 74,800 shares of the company's stock after selling 43,002 shares during the quarter. GSA Capital Partners LLP owned approximately 0.10% of Energizer worth $2,238,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Insiders Place Their Bets

In other Energizer news, Director Patrick J. Moore acquired 10,000 shares of the st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, May 12th. The shares were acquired at an average cost of $23.10 per share, with a total value of $231,000.00. Following the transaction, the director owned 15,000 shares of the company's stock, valued at $346,500. The trade was a 200.00% increase in their position. Energizer (NYSE:ENR -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, May 6th. The company reported $0.67 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.68 by ($0.01). The company had revenue of $662.90 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$670.85 million. Energizer had a net margin of 1.87% and a return on equity of 184.22%. The company's revenue for the quarter was down .1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$0.72 EPS. On average, analysts anticipate that Energizer Holdings, Inc. will post 3.58 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Energizer

(Free Report)

Energizer Holdings,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ures, markets, and distributes household batteries, specialty batteries, and lighting products worldwide. It offers lithium, alkaline, carbon zinc, nickel metal hydride, zinc air, and silver oxide batteries under the Energizer, Eveready, and Rayovac brands; primary, rechargeable, specialty, and hearing aid batteries; and handheld, headlights, lanterns, and area lights, as well as flashlights under the Hard Case, Dolphin, and WeatherReady brands.
